?在互聯(lián)網(wǎng)時(shí)代,一個(gè)功能齊全、設(shè)計(jì)精美的網(wǎng)站不僅僅是企業(yè)或個(gè)人的展示窗口,更是與全球用戶連接的橋梁。那么,從頭開始搭建一個(gè)網(wǎng)站到底需要哪些步驟?如何從規(guī)劃到上線,再到后期優(yōu)化,一步步實(shí)現(xiàn)你的數(shù)字化夢(mèng)想?這份全流程技術(shù)指南將為你揭開網(wǎng)站搭建的神秘面紗,助你成為網(wǎng)站建設(shè)的“老司機(jī)”!
?1. 網(wǎng)站架構(gòu)與規(guī)劃:打好基礎(chǔ),事半功倍??
網(wǎng)站建設(shè)的第一步,就像蓋房子前的藍(lán)圖設(shè)計(jì),必須清晰、全面。??
?明確目標(biāo):你的目標(biāo)是品牌展示、內(nèi)容分享,還是服務(wù)提供?這將決定網(wǎng)站的核心功能和風(fēng)格。??
?分析受眾:目標(biāo)用戶是誰?他們的需求和習(xí)慣是什么?確定受眾將幫助你設(shè)計(jì)更貼合的用戶體驗(yàn)。??
?規(guī)劃信息架構(gòu):合理的導(dǎo)航結(jié)構(gòu)和內(nèi)容分類,能夠讓用戶快速找到所需信息,提升整體體驗(yàn)。??
?功能清單:列出你希望網(wǎng)站具備的功能模塊,如會(huì)員系統(tǒng)、在線支付、博客模塊等,為后續(xù)開發(fā)指明方向。??
小建議:??
使用思維導(dǎo)圖工具(如XMind或MindMeister)整理和可視化你的規(guī)劃思路,清晰又高效。
?2. 網(wǎng)站開發(fā)工具與技術(shù):搭建網(wǎng)站的“三駕馬車”??
前端技術(shù):??
前端是用戶眼中看到的一切,常用的前端技術(shù)包括:??
?HTML:負(fù)責(zé)網(wǎng)頁結(jié)構(gòu),就像房子的骨架。??
?CSS:負(fù)責(zé)頁面樣式,定義顏色、字體、布局等,賦予網(wǎng)站美感。??
?JavaScript:負(fù)責(zé)交互功能,如按鈕點(diǎn)擊、動(dòng)態(tài)加載等,讓網(wǎng)站更生動(dòng)。??
后端技術(shù):??
后端是網(wǎng)站的“隱形大腦”,負(fù)責(zé)數(shù)據(jù)處理和邏輯實(shí)現(xiàn)。??
?常見語言:PHP(經(jīng)典之選)、Python(靈活高效)、Java(性能強(qiáng)大)。??
?功能支持:用戶登錄驗(yàn)證、數(shù)據(jù)存儲(chǔ)操作、動(dòng)態(tài)內(nèi)容生成等全靠后端完成。??
數(shù)據(jù)庫:??
數(shù)據(jù)庫是網(wǎng)站的數(shù)據(jù)倉庫,用來存儲(chǔ)用戶信息、文章內(nèi)容等。??
?常用數(shù)據(jù)庫:MySQL(流行且易用)、Oracle(大型企業(yè)常用)、MongoDB(NoSQL代表)。??
技術(shù)棧靈活選擇:??
如果偏愛快速開發(fā),可以嘗試使用一體化框架(如Django、Laravel),大幅提高開發(fā)效率。
?3. 網(wǎng)站搭建步驟:化繁為簡(jiǎn),逐步推進(jìn)??
① 域名注冊(cè)與服務(wù)器選擇??
?域名注冊(cè):為你的網(wǎng)站選擇一個(gè)獨(dú)特且易記的地址(如www.yourbrand.com)。推薦使用知名域名注冊(cè)商,如阿里云、GoDaddy等。??
?服務(wù)器選擇:根據(jù)流量需求選擇合適的主機(jī)類型(如共享主機(jī)、云服務(wù)器)。阿里云、騰訊云、AWS等是不錯(cuò)的選擇。??
② 環(huán)境搭建??
?開發(fā)環(huán)境:安裝服務(wù)器軟件(如Apache或Nginx)、配置數(shù)據(jù)庫和語言運(yùn)行環(huán)境(如PHP、Node.js)。??
?本地測(cè)試環(huán)境:為開發(fā)團(tuán)隊(duì)搭建一個(gè)協(xié)作環(huán)境,推薦使用XAMPP、Docker等工具,方便開發(fā)與測(cè)試。??
③ 設(shè)計(jì)與開發(fā)??
?UI/UX設(shè)計(jì):確定網(wǎng)站的視覺風(fēng)格和交互體驗(yàn),使用工具如Figma或Sketch進(jìn)行原型設(shè)計(jì)。??
?前后端開發(fā):前端負(fù)責(zé)頁面的視覺與交互,后端負(fù)責(zé)邏輯與數(shù)據(jù)支持,協(xié)同完成整個(gè)網(wǎng)站的搭建。??
④ 測(cè)試與上線??
?全面測(cè)試:對(duì)網(wǎng)站的功能、瀏覽器兼容性、響應(yīng)式設(shè)計(jì)、加載速度等進(jìn)行詳細(xì)測(cè)試,找出并修復(fù)所有問題。??
?正式上線:將網(wǎng)站部署到生產(chǎn)服務(wù)器上,并為域名綁定服務(wù)器IP,正式面向用戶開放。??
小貼士:??
在上線前,務(wù)必設(shè)置HTTPS加密,提升網(wǎng)站安全性,同時(shí)增強(qiáng)用戶信任。
?4. 網(wǎng)站優(yōu)化與維護(hù):打造高效、安全的長(zhǎng)久體驗(yàn)??
① 性能優(yōu)化??
?圖片壓縮:使用工具(如TinyPNG)壓縮圖片,減少頁面加載時(shí)間。??
?代碼優(yōu)化:合并CSS與JS文件、移除冗余代碼,提升運(yùn)行效率。??
?CDN加速:通過內(nèi)容分發(fā)網(wǎng)絡(luò)(如Cloudflare)提高全球訪問速度,特別適合國際化網(wǎng)站。??
② SEO優(yōu)化??
?關(guān)鍵詞布局:在標(biāo)題、描述、內(nèi)容中合理植入關(guān)鍵詞,提高搜索排名。??
?鏈接優(yōu)化:優(yōu)化URL結(jié)構(gòu),確保簡(jiǎn)短易讀,同時(shí)增加優(yōu)質(zhì)內(nèi)外部鏈接。??
?站點(diǎn)地圖:生成XML站點(diǎn)地圖,提交至搜索引擎,讓你的網(wǎng)站更容易被抓取。??
③ 安全維護(hù)??
?備份數(shù)據(jù):定期備份網(wǎng)站內(nèi)容,以防數(shù)據(jù)丟失。??
?漏洞修復(fù):及時(shí)更新網(wǎng)站插件、系統(tǒng)版本,修復(fù)潛在漏洞。??
?防攻擊措施:?jiǎn)⒂梅阑饓Α⒃O(shè)置強(qiáng)密碼,防范惡意攻擊。??
④ 數(shù)據(jù)監(jiān)測(cè)??
通過Google Analytics或cnzz統(tǒng)計(jì)監(jiān)測(cè)網(wǎng)站流量、用戶行為,持續(xù)優(yōu)化內(nèi)容和功能,保持競(jìng)爭(zhēng)力。
我們專注高端建站,小程序開發(fā)、軟件系統(tǒng)定制開發(fā)、BUG修復(fù)、物聯(lián)網(wǎng)開發(fā)、各類API接口對(duì)接開發(fā)等。十余年開發(fā)經(jīng)驗(yàn),每一個(gè)項(xiàng)目承諾做到滿意為止,多一次對(duì)比,一定讓您多一份收獲!